Laptop graphics are quite different in the way they are implemented on mobile PC's.
For a start, very few Laptops have a dedicated graphics card within, most are "onboard solutions", (which is almost a misnomer).
The laptops that do have a dedicated card often have that card tied into the bios for that PC, making any upgrade difficult if not impossible.
